LTA HAMPSHIRE

LTA Hampshire

LTA Hampshire street SingaporeOverviewIntroduction:LTA Hampshire Highway Singapore refers to the Land Transportation Authority's (LTA) management and infrastructure improvement of Hampshire Highway in Singapore. This bustling road is found during the central location of Singapore, providing crucial connectivity concerning different neighborhoods an

read more